Description Oxford Nanopore Technologies is headquartered at the Oxford Science Park outside Oxford, UK, with satellite offices and a commercial presence in global locations across the US, APAC and Europe. In this role, you will be responsible for developing, managing, and implementing the regional marketing strategy for AMR region. This role will also provide support to facilitate and enable the channel partners across the AMR region, to help reach the company’s revenue goals and translate market insights and product knowledge into competitive strategies and tactics. As the Director of Regional Marketing, you will work closely with colleagues in global marketing and commercial leadership in AMR to ensure alignment of focus areas to support the region's commercial goals. You will monitor the overall performance of the marketing activities in the assigned territories in the region in line with the company’s global strategic priorities and business growth. The Details… The ideal candidate for this position will have demonstrated the ability to lead high-performing teams, as well as have a solid understanding of the genomics market in the region with success in developing product market strategies, both short and medium term, including planning and executing of regional strategies and growing market penetration. Key responsibilities include, but are not limited to: Regional marketing strategic vision è Marketing operational success Define, develop and implement regional marketing strategies that align with the overall business goals and drive growth in the region. Translate regional market trends, competitive landscape, and customer insights to inform global marketing decisions, product roadmap and optimise local strategies including regional enablement. Lead the company’s new product launches in the region and upsell strategies for on-market solutions; design omnichannel campaigns (including digital, events, and partners) tailored for the region. Oversee and drive integrated and innovative marketing campaigns and events that differentiate the brand and contribute to the sales opportunity pipeline. Identify and oversee the implementation of marketing initiatives through the execution of campaigns, events, and regional projects to drive business growth. Own regional marketing budgets, ensuring efficient allocation of resources with clear return on investment. Partner with the Regional Commercial VP/GM as well Strategic Marketing leadership to jointly deliver revenue objectives through marketing pipeline-building initiatives with developed data-driven insights on regional customers and behaviour, applications and market segments. Partner with regional sales and channel partners to build marketing-driven pipeline, enable adoption of global tools, competitive messaging, and localised campaigns to accelerate adoption. Represent as a senior marketing voice at major regional conferences and customer-facing events. Team Leadership Lead the regional marketing team (Associate Directors/Managers) in building a high-performing, collaborative, data-driven culture. Act as a senior member of the regional leadership team (matrixed with global and regional functions), participating in business planning, budgeting, forecasting and cross-functional collaboration. Establish and monitor key marketing metrics and report results to regional commercial leadership and global marketing leadership. Ensure global cross-functional collaboration with regional counterparts across EMEAI and APAC. Any other duties as might be required within the remit and responsibilities of the post. What We're Looking For... Advanced degree in a biological sciences discipline (MSc/PhD preferred) Minimum of 10 years of progressive marketing experience in the life sciences/genomics sector, including at least 3-5 years in a senior regional marketing/segment marketing leadership role supporting multiple countries/territories. Proven track record of defining and executing marketing strategies that deliver measurable commercial growth. Deep knowledge of genomic sequencing or adjacent life science/biotech market segments (research, translational, clinical, applied) and commercial dynamics, including channel partners, KOLs and local networks/consortia. Exceptional leadership, communication skills, with the ability to translate strategy into action, guide a team, and influence across functions to drive execution. Demonstrate experience in leading teams, managing budgets, operating in a global or matrix organisation, and influencing cross-functional stakeholders. Strong commercial acumen; proven ability to work hand-in-hand with sales leadership and channel partners. Familiarity with marketing automation/CRM tools (e.g., Salesforce), campaign analytics/data-driven decision-making (e.g. KPIs, reporting, ROI). The company has developed a new generation of nanopore-based sensing technology for faster, information rich, accessible and affordable molecular analysis. The first application is DNA/RNA sequencing, and the technology is in development for the analysis of other types of molecules including proteins. The technology is used to understand and characterise the biology of humans and diseases such as cancer, plants, animals, bacteria, viruses, and whole environments. With a thriving culture of ambition and strong innovation goals, Oxford Nanopore is a UK headquartered company with global operations and customers in more than 125 countries.
